#打印文件属性信息 import os#os.stat()返回的文件属性元组元素的含义 filestats=os.stat('yesterday')#获取文件/目录的状态 print(filestats)
import os,stat filestats=os.stat('yesterday') print(filestats[stat.ST_SIZE]) print(filestats[stat.ST_MTIME]) print(filestats[stat.ST_ATIME]) print(filestats[stat.ST_CTIME]) #打印指定文件的创建时间 import os,stat,time# stat()函数返回的文件时间都是一个长整数,time模块ctime()函数将它们转换成可读的时间字符串 filestats=os.stat('yesterday') print(time.ctime(filestats[stat.ST_CTIME])) #复制文件 import shutil shutil.copy('C:\Users\Administrator\PycharmProjects\s14\day1\yesterday', 'C:\Users\Administrator\Desktop\yersterday.txt') '''移动文件用的是shutil模块中的move()函数,与上述copy()函数用法类似''' #删除文件 import os os.remove('C:\Users\Administrator\PycharmProjects\s14\day1\xxx') #重命名文件 import os os.rename('C:\Users\Administrator\Desktop\yersterday.txt', 'C:\Users\Administrator\Desktop\yerster.txt')